Transaction ea758108ddf986f33bdd3a6060a088efa406c0a3857a6474dca1de41e508b2c3

1 Input
2 Outputs
  • ea758108ddf986f33bdd3a6060a088efa406c0a3857a6474dca1de41e508b2c3:0
  • value  250095
    address  3AQhmTfvy7SVW2Egfix4ZMazP8fRgkEx8f
  • ea758108ddf986f33bdd3a6060a088efa406c0a3857a6474dca1de41e508b2c3:1
  • value  267734
    address  19BX6TgeAWVcooERf7fEr5ES6jWNPtaCcL